XmlMappedRange.Replace(Object, Object, Object, Object, Object, Object, Object, Object) Methode

Definition

Ersetzt die angegebenen Zeichen im XmlMappedRange-Steuerelement durch eine neue Zeichenfolge.

public bool Replace (object What, object Replacement, object LookAt, object SearchOrder, object MatchCase, object MatchByte, object SearchFormat, object ReplaceFormat);

Parameter

What
Object

Die Zeichenfolge, die Microsoft Office Excel für Sie suchen soll.

Replacement
Object

Die Ersatzzeichenfolge.

LookAt
Object

Kann eine der folgenden XlLookAt-Konstanten sein: xlWhole oder xlPart.

SearchOrder
Object

Kann eine der folgenden XlSearchOrder-Konstanten sein: xlByRows oder xlByColumns.

MatchCase
Object

true, um bei der Suche Groß- und Kleinschreibung zu unterscheiden.

MatchByte
Object

Sie können dieses Argument nur verwenden, wenn Sie die Unterstützung für Doppelbytezeichen in Excel ausgewählt oder installiert haben. true, wenn Doppelbytezeichen nur Doppelbytezeichen entsprechen sollen. false, wenn eine Übereinstimmung der Doppelbytezeichen mit ihren entsprechenden Einzelbytezeichen zulässig ist.

SearchFormat
Object

Das Suchformat für die Methode.

ReplaceFormat
Object

Das Ersetzungsformat für die Methode.

Gibt zurück

Boolean

true, wenn sich die angegebenen Zeichen in dem XmlMappedRange-Steuerelement befinden; andernfalls false.

Beispiele

Im folgenden Codebeispiel wird die- Replace Methode verwendet, um die Zeichenfolge "Smith" durch die Zeichenfolge "Jones" in zu ersetzen XmlMappedRange . In diesem Codebeispiel wird davon ausgegangen, dass das aktuelle Arbeitsblatt einen mit dem XmlMappedRange Namen enthält CustomerLastNameCell .

private void ReplaceSmith()
{
    this.CustomerLastNameCell.Value2 = "Walker, Smith, James";
    this.CustomerLastNameCell.Replace("Smith", "Jones");
}
Private Sub ReplaceSmith()
    Me.CustomerLastNameCell.Value2 = "Walker, Smith, James"
    Me.CustomerLastNameCell.Replace("Smith", "Jones")
End Sub

Hinweise

Durch die Verwendung dieser Methode wird weder die Auswahl noch die aktive Zelle geändert.

Die Einstellungen für LookAt , SearchOrder , MatchCase und MatchByte werden jedes Mal gespeichert, wenn Sie diese Methode verwenden. Wenn Sie beim nächsten Aufruf der-Methode keine Werte für diese Argumente angeben, werden die gespeicherten Werte verwendet. Wenn Sie diese Argumente festlegen, werden die Einstellungen im Dialogfeld Suchen geändert, und durch das Ändern der Einstellungen im Dialogfeld Suchen werden die gespeicherten Werte geändert, die verwendet werden, wenn Sie die Argumente weglassen. Um Probleme zu vermeiden, legen Sie diese Argumente bei jeder Verwendung dieser Methode explizit fest.

Optionale Parameter

Weitere Informationen zu optionalen Parametern finden Sie unter optionale Parameter in Office-Projektmappen.

Gilt für